| 20 | /* |
| 21 | * TCP sequence numbers are 32 bit integers operated |
| 22 | * on with modular arithmetic. These macros can be |
| 23 | * used to compare such integers. |
| 24 | */ |
| 25 | #define SEQ_LT(a,b) ((int)((a)-(b)) < 0) |
| 26 | #define SEQ_LEQ(a,b) ((int)((a)-(b)) <= 0) |
| 27 | #define SEQ_GT(a,b) ((int)((a)-(b)) > 0) |
| 28 | #define SEQ_GEQ(a,b) ((int)((a)-(b)) >= 0) |
| 29 | |
| 30 | /* |
| 31 | * Macros to initialize tcp sequence numbers for |
| 32 | * send and receive from initial send and receive |
| 33 | * sequence numbers. |
| 34 | */ |
| 35 | #define tcp_rcvseqinit(tp) \ |
| 36 | (tp)->rcv_adv = (tp)->rcv_nxt = (tp)->irs + 1 |
| 37 | |
| 38 | #define tcp_sendseqinit(tp) \ |
| 39 | (tp)->snd_una = (tp)->snd_nxt = (tp)->snd_max = (tp)->snd_up = \ |
| 40 | (tp)->iss |
| 41 | |
| 42 | #define TCP_ISSINCR (125*1024) /* increment for tcp_iss each second */ |
| 43 | |
| 44 | #ifdef KERNEL |
| 45 | tcp_seq tcp_iss; /* tcp initial send seq # */ |
| 46 | #endif |
